Transaction d0536f33b9cab82b0858c650e24bc416d62b02d420aaad97f80dd48e95166715

25 Input
2 Outputs
  • d0536f33b9cab82b0858c650e24bc416d62b02d420aaad97f80dd48e95166715:0
  • value  1167418
    address  1GX4dob3cBLfjQvDRn4HwUgB2CDFXu4adE
  • d0536f33b9cab82b0858c650e24bc416d62b02d420aaad97f80dd48e95166715:1
  • value  234221476
    address  13i33ou9eB9TEbmheCimatgACP8rMSUk4F